(54) ГЕНЕРАТОР ИМПУЛЬСОВ С
УПРАВЛЯЕМОЙ ЧАСТОТОЙ
название | год | авторы | номер документа |
---|---|---|---|
Генератор импульсов с управляемой частотой | 1986 |
|
SU1374414A1 |
Генератор импульсов с управляемой частотой | 1980 |
|
SU907814A2 |
Генератор импульсов с управляемойчАСТОТОй | 1979 |
|
SU834940A2 |
Генератор импульсов | 1989 |
|
SU1677852A2 |
Генератор импульсов с управляемой частотой | 1979 |
|
SU879781A2 |
Генератор импульсов с управляемой частотой | 1978 |
|
SU744917A1 |
Генератор импульсов с управляемой частотой | 1980 |
|
SU944114A2 |
Генератор импульсов с управляемой частотой | 1979 |
|
SU855947A2 |
Генератор импульсов управляемой частоты | 1987 |
|
SU1451832A1 |
Генератор импульсов с управляемойчАСТОТОй | 1979 |
|
SU843253A2 |
Изобретение относится к импульсной технике и может быть использовано в качестве задающего генератора в устройствах автоматики и вьзчислительной техники.
Известен генератор импульсов регулируемой длительности, содержащий счетчик, элемент ИЛИ, задающий генератор, Т-триггер, шифратор, элементы И, RS-триггер и источники управляющих импульсов длительности и интервала 1 .
Недостатками данного генератора являются невысокое быстродействие и сложность, обусловленная тем, что с увеличением числа генерируемых частот с различными длительностями. импульсов пропорционально увеличивается число источников управляющих импульсов длительности и интервала.
Наиболее близким техническим решением к предлагаемому.является, генератор импульсов с управляемой частотой, содержащий три элемента И/ элемент ИЛИ, два управляющих триггера, линию задержки, счетчик, триггер, первый и второй регистры 23.
Недостатком известного генератора является невозможность раздельного
управления длительностью и периодом следования импульсов.
Цель изобретения - расширение функциональных возможностей.
Поставленная цель достигается тем, что в генератор, содержащий три элемента И, элемент ИЛИ, два управляющих триггера, линию задерж.ки, счетчик, триггер, первый и вто10рой регистры, входы записи информации которых соединены, соответственно, с шиной кода длительности импульсов и с шиной кода длительности временного интервала между импульса15ми, а вход считывания информации первого регистра соединен с выходом линии задержки, вход которой соединен с выходом элемента ИЛИ, один вход которого соединен с выходом
20 первого элемента И и со счетными входами управляющих триггеров, а второй вход - с выходом третьего элемента И, одни входы которого соединены, соответственно, с прямым выходом пер25вого разряда и инверсными выходами всех последую11Ц1х разрядов счетчика, а последний вход - с вычитающим входом счетчика и выходом второго элемента И, первый вход которого соеди30нен с прямым выходом второго управляющего триггера, а второй вход - с шиной импульсоЕ эталонной частоты и первым входом первого элемента И, третий вход которого соединен с инверсчым выходом второго управляющег триггера, а второй вход - с прямым выходом первого управляющего тригге ра, вход установки которого соедине с шиной пуска генератора, введены два блока элементов И и блок элементов ИЛИ, вьлход которого соединен с входом установки счетчика, а перв и второй входы - с выходами соответ ствующих блоков элементов И, вторые входы которых соединены с выходами первого и второго регистров соответ ственно,первый вход первого блока элементов И соединен с прямым выходом триггера, который является выходом генератора, а первый вход вто рого блока элементов И - с инверсным выходом.триггера, счетный вход которого соединен с входом линии за держки, выход которой соединен с входом считывания инфррмации второг регистра. На чертеже представлена блок-схе ма генератора импульсов с управляемой частотой. Генератор содержит управляющие триггеры 1 и 2, прямые выходы которых соединены, соответственно, с первыми входами элементов И 3 и 4, вторые входь, которых соединены межд .собой и с ашной 5 импульсов эталонной частоты, а инверсный выход управляющего триггера 2 соединен с третьим входом элемента И 3. Вход установки управляющего триггера 1 соединен с шиной б пуска. Выход элемента И 3 соединен со счетными входами управляющих триггеров 1 и 2 и с первыг входом элемента ИЛИ 7, второй вход которого соединен с вых дом элемента И 8. Выход элемента И 4 соединен с вычитающим входом счетчика 9 и первым входом элемента И 8, остальные входы которого соединены, соответст венно, с прямым выходом Q первого разряда и инверсными выходами Q(3,...,Qf, всех последующих разрядов счетчика 9. Выход элемента ИЛИ 7 соединен с входом линии 10 задержки и счетным входом триггера 11. Выход линии 10 задержки соединен с входами считывания регистров 12 и 13, входы записи информации которых соединены, соответственно, с шинами 14 кода дли1;ельнЬсти импульса и 15 кода длительности временного интервала между импульсами. Выходы регистров 12 и 13 соедине ны, соответственно, с первыми входа ми блоков 16 и 17 элемента И, выход которых через блок 18 элементов ИЛИ соединены с входом установки счетчи ка 9, а вторые входы, соответственно, с прямым и инверсным выходами триггера 11, причемпрямой выход соединен с выходной шиной генератора 19. Генератор работает следующим образом. Перед началом работы триггеры 1, 2 -и 11, счетчик 9 и регистры 12 и 13 устанавливаются в нуль. На прямых выходах триггеров 1 и 2 устанавливаются низкие потенциалы, препятствующие прохождению на выходы элементов И 3 и 4 импульсов эталонной частоты, поступающей на шину 5. Затем на шины 14 и 15 поступают коды чисел N-,, N(, задающие соответственно, длительность генерируемых импульсов и временной интервал между ними, и записываются в регистры 12 и 13. По команде Пуск,поступающей на шину 6, триггер 1 устанавливается в состояние 1, открывая по второму входу элемент И 3, открытый по тре- тьему входу высоким потенциалом с инверсного выхода триггера 2. Затем ближайший по времени к команде Пуск импульс эталонной частоты проходит на выход элемента И 3, с выхода элемента И 3 через элемент ИЛИ 7 на счетный вход триггера 11, переводя его. по заднему фронту в состояние 1 и, формируя тем самым передний фронт генерируемого импульса, и через линию 10 задержки на входы считывания регистров 12 и 13. Информация из регистра 12 поступает на первый вход блока 16 элементов И, открытый по второму входу высоким потенциалом с прямого выхода триггера 11, и далее, с выхода блока 16 элементов И через блок 18 элементов ИЛИ, на вход установки счетчика 9, устанавливая его в состояние, соответствующее коду числа N. Импульс . эталонной частоты с выхода элемента И 3 поступает также на счетные входы триггеров 1 и 2, переводя триггер 1 в состояние О, а триггер 2 в состояние 1. При этом элемент И 3 закрывается по второму и третьему входам, причем низкий потенциал с инверсного выхода триггера 2 исключает возможность прохождения через элемент И 3 импульса эталонной частоты при повторном появлении на шине 6 команды Пуск, тем самым предотвращая сбой работы генератора, а элемент И 4 открывается, пропуская все последующие импульсы эталонной частоты на вычитающий вход счетчик 9 и первый вход элемента И 8. Импульсы эталонной частоты, поступающие на вход счетчика 9, вычитают из его содержимого по единице. Когда содержимое счетчика 9 становится равным единице, т.е. на его вход поступит импульсов, на выходах всех его разрядов устанавливаются высокие потенциалы, элемент И 8 открываются. импульс эталонной частоты проходит через элемент И 8 и элемент ИЛИ 7 на счетный вход триггера 11, переводя его по заднему фронту в состояние О и формируя тем самым задний фронт генерируемого .импульса, а также через линию 10 задержки на входы считывания регистров 12 и 13, Информация из регистра 13 поступает на первый вход блока 17 элементов И, открытый по второму входу высоким потенциалом с инверсного выхода триггера 11, и далее, с выхода блока 17 элемента И через блок 18 элементов ИЛИ на вход установки счетчика 9, устанавливая его в состояние, соответствующее коду числа NIJ , Импульсы эталонной частоты, продолжающие поступать на вход счетчика 9, вычитают из его содержимого по единице. Когда содержимое счетчика 9 становится равным единице, т.е. на его вход поступает импульсов эталонной частоты, на выходах всех его разрядов устанавливаются высокие потенциалы, элемент И 8 открывается N(-K импульс эталонной частоты проходит через элемент И 8 и элемент ИЛИ 7 на счетный вход триггера. 11, переводя его по заднему фронту в состояние 1, а также через линию задержки 10 на входы счи тывания регистров 12 и 13. Далее работа генера тора происходит аналогично вышеописанной. Чтобы избежать одновременного поступления и импульсов на вычитающий вход счетчика 9 и информа ции из регистров 12 и 13 на вход установки счетчика 9, время задержки линии 10 задержки выбирается из усло , где f - время задержки линии задерж ки,длительность импульсов эталонной частоты период следования импульсов эталонной частоты. Предлагаемое техническое решение по сравнению с известным имеет более широкие функциональные возможности, которые заключаются в том, что генерируемые импульсы могут управляться по длительности. Это достигается вве дением в генератор двух блоков элементов И и блока элементов ИЛИ. Триггер 11 обеспечивает формирование импульсов, длительность которых опре деляется кодом основного регистра, а временной интервал между импульсами - кодом дополнительного регистра Блоки элементов И и блок элементов ИЛИ совместно с триггером обеспечива ют попеременную запись в счетчик одов чисел, записанных в основном дополнительном регистрах. Предлагаемый генератор имеет также повыенную надежность работы за счет го, что инверсный выход второго управляющего триггера соединен с третьим входом первого элемента И. Поэтому в процессе работы генератора низкий потенциал синверсного выхода второго управлягацего триггера закрывает по третьему входу первый элемент И, и поступление на вход пуска случайной команды не вызывает сбой работы генератора. Формула изобретения Генератор импульсов с управляемой частотой, содержащий три элемента И, элемент ИЛИ,.два управляющих триггера, линию задержки, счетчик, триггер, первый и второйрегистры, входы записи информации которых соединены, соответственно , с шиной кода длительности импульсов и с шиной кода длительности временного интервала между импульсами, а вход считывания информации первого регистра соединен с выходом линии задержки, вход которой соединен с выходом элемента ИЛИ, один вход которого соединен с выходом первого элемента И и со счетными входами управляющих триггеров, а второй вход - с выходом третьего элемента И, одни входы которого соединены, соответственно, с прямым выходом первого разряда и инверсными выходами всех последующих разрядов счетчика, а последний вход с вычитающим входом счетчика и эыходом второго элемента И, первый вход которого соединен с прямым выходом второго управляющего триггера, а второй вход - с шиной импульсов эталонной частоты и первым входом первого элемента И, третий вход которого соединен с инверсным выходом второго управляющего триггера, а второй вход - с прямым выходом первого управляющего триггера, вход установки которого соединен с шиной пуска генератора, отличающийся тем, что, с целью расширения функциональных возможностей, в него введены два блока элементов И и блок элементов ИЛИ, выход которого соединен с входом установки счетчика, а первый и второй входы - с выходами соответствующих блоков элементов И, вторые входы которых соединены с выходами первого и второго регистров соответственно,первый вход первого блока элементов И соединен с прямым выходом триггера, который является выходом генератора, а первый вход второго блока элементов И с инверсным выходом триггера, счетный вход котброго соединен с входом
линии задержки, выход которого соединен с входом считывания информации второго регистра.
Источники информации, принятые во внимание при экспертизе
ff
1
кл. Н 03 L 7/00, 17.04.80,
/
1
Авторы
Даты
1982-08-07—Публикация
1980-09-10—Подача